IGN64 has posted an interview with John Tobias about the latest addition to the Mortal Kombat saga, Mortal Kombat: Special Forces. MK: Special Forces is the follow up 3D action/adventure game to MK Mythologies: Sub-Zero. Here is a little blurb from the interview.
IGN64: How does MK: Special Forces compare to past MK incarnations? Is it more story-based a la MK Mythologies or is it a fighter?


Tobias: It's not much like Mythologies, which was in essence a side-scroller. The pacing of Mythologies was more based on throwing enemies at the player. And there were real simple exploration elements; you know, find a key here, pick it up and go find the door that it opens.



Special Forces is a little bit different in that, because you are actually traversing in a true 3D environment, we can sort of slow the pacing down a bit. We don’t have to constantly throw enemies at the player. MK Mythologies was set up so it was a trial and error thing – you try something, you die, you go back and try something else. This one isn’t based around this at all. It's different in that sense. There is still a large exploration element, there is still a large fighting element to the game, quite obviously because it’s a Mortal Kombat title. I’d say right now we're about 40-50% exploration and the rest is fighting. Of course, that can change a lot as we’re real early in development. Who knows what it's going to end up as?

Mortal Kombat Conquest returns to all new episodes this week. This week's episode is titled Shadow of a Doubt and next week's is titled Reptile Story. In the Shadow of a Doubt episode, the evil Shao Kahn sends an impostor Kitana to kill Kung Lao. Check your local listings for exact times and channels, or check out Threshold's Mortal Kombat website. In addition to local channels, TNT is airing these new episodes the following week after WCW Monday Night Nitro on Monday nights at 11:00pm EST. IGN64 released their list of the Best Games of 1998 for the Nintendo64. Mortal Kombat 4 received the award for Best Fighting Game for 1998. IGN64 applauded Eurocom's work in a "nearly flawless" translation from the arcade.

Next Week's episode of Mortal Kombat Conquest promises to be a good one. In The Serpent and the Ice, Scorpion and Sub-Zero team up against Kung Lao, Siro, and Taja.
